Report of the Treasurer of Maryland Containing Accounts Rendered to and Settled With the Comptroller of the Treasury From 30th Sept. 1881 to 1st Oct. 1883.; Volume 1884
<p>This is Volume 1884 of the Report of the Treasurer of Maryland covering accounts rendered and settled with the Comptroller of the Treasury from September 30 1881 to October 1 1883. Authored by Barnes Compton this historical document provides a detailed overview of the state's financial activities during this period. It offers valuable insights into the fiscal management accounting practices and economic conditions of Maryland in the late 19th century.
